#07A235 Color
#07A235 is rgb(7, 162, 53) in RGB, hsl(138, 92%, 33%) in HSL, and about cmyk(96%, 0%, 67%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Green (Pantone) (#00AD43),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.77.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#07A235 Channel Values
How #07A235 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 7 · G 162 · B 53 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 138° · S 92% · L 33%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 138° · S 96%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 96% · M 0% · Y 67%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.37:1 vs white · 6.23: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#07A235 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#07A235?
#07A235 is a dark green — rgb(7, 162, 53) in RGB and hsl(138, 92%, 33%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Green (Pantone) (#00AD43),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.77.
What is the RGB value of #07A235?
#07A235 is rgb(7, 162, 53) — red 7, green 162, and blue 53 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#07A235?
#07A235 converts to approximately cmyk(96%, 0%, 67%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#07A235 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#07A235 scores 3.37:1 against white and 6.23: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#07A235 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#07A235 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is forestgreen (#228B22) at a CIE76 distance of 11.07, which is visibly different.
